In 2019-2020, 12,258 people earned their degree in biomedical engineering, making the major the 75th most popular in the United States. In 2017-2018, biomedical engineering gra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$58,234 and had an average of $23,170 in loans still to pay off.

Across Minnesota, there were 149 biomedical eng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$59,700 and $22,000 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 19 biomedical eng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$71,467 and $103,128 respectively.

University of Minnesota - Twin Cities

Minneapolis, Minnesota
#1 in overall quality

Out of the 1 schools in the Best Value Bio Engineering Schools for a Doctorate in Minnesota that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Minnesota - Twin Cities landed the #1 spot on the list. UMN Twin Cities is a large school located in Minneapolis, Minnesota that handed out 12 doctorate’s bio engineering degrees in 2019-2020.

In addition to being on our minnesota doctor’s degree bio engineering students list, UMN Twin Cities has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Biomedical Engineering Doctor’s Degree Schools in Minnesota” ranking. Although you might pay more or less depending on your area of study, average graduate tuition and fees at UMN Twin Cities are $28,845.
